We’re looking for an enthusiastic and proactive Learning and Development Assistant to join our Exeter office on a permanent basis.

This role will sit within the HR Hub in our brilliant HR department; supporting the Learning & Development (L&D) team in delivering an effective service to the firm, through the efficient organisation and coordination of administration training and events. The role will also provide efficient administration to support the generalist HR Hub team.

The role

We see this role as being essential to the smooth running of the L&D and wider HR team, so this is an exciting opportunity to join the fold and make a valuable contribution!

You will provide generalist L&D administration support including data input, preparing and generating reporting information and co-ordinating training events and sessions for the L&D team. You will assist in maintaining the Learning Hub System to ensure all employee data is accurate, updating relevant details and training records.

This role will also be supporting the annual co-ordination of the L&D delivery plan, liaising with different stakeholders and departments within the firm; and completing the associated paperwork. You will have ownership of the Learning Hub Inbox, responding to queries and requests within a timely manner.

Although this role is the lead administrative support to the L&D team, you will also be required to provide support and cover for the wider HR Hub team and department, including updating the People Hub HR system and assisting with relevant HR projects.
